Solution
return a function:
function func(_func) {
this._func = _func;
return function() {
alert("called a function");
this._func();
}
}
var test = new func(function() {
// do something
});
test();
but then `this` refers to the returned function (right?) or window, you will have to cache `this` to access it from inside the function (`this._func();`)
function func(_func) {
var that = this;
this._func = _func;
return function() {
alert("called a function");
that._func();
}
}
Problem
Is it possible to set a default function on an object, such that when I call `myObj()` that function is executed? Let's say I have the following `func` object ``` function func(_func) { this._func = _func; this.call = function() { alert("called a function"); this._func(); } } var test = new func(function() { // do something }); test.call(); ``` I'd like to replace `test.call()` with simply `test()`. Is that possible?
